Aztec Men's Soccer Falls on Road at UCLA

November 16, 2014

LOS ANGELES – A late goal by senior Pablo Vasquez wasn’t quite enough on Sunday afternoon, as the San Diego State Aztec men’s soccer team concluded its 2014 season with a narrow road loss to No. 6 UCLA, 2-1, at Drake Stadium.

 

Vasquez’s goal came on a free kick in the 90th minute to give the Aztecs one last chance of a late rally, but time was not on their side by that point in the match. UCLA took the lead in the first half, as Leo Stolz scored in the 31st minute off a double assist from Chase Gasper and Willie Raygoza.

 

The Bruins tacked on a critical insurance goal to extend their lead to 2-0 in the 68th minute, when Abu Danladi dribbled past SDSU redshirt freshman goalkeeper Adam Allmaras and knocked it through an empty net.

 

SDSU (7-12, 1-9 Pac-12) lost for just the second time in eight matches this season when scoring last in a contest. It’s also the ninth match the Aztecs have lost by one goal this year, including their seventh one-goal loss to a ranked opponent, as seven of San Diego State’s nine Pac-12 defeats have been by just one goal.

 

The Pac-12 has been the No. 1 RPI conference in Division I throughout this season, as it entered the week with the top winning percentage (.627), the best road winning percentage (.553) and the best strength of schedule based on opponents winning percentage (.590) in the country.

 

Junior Rene Reyes recorded a team-high three shots on Sunday, while Vasquez finished with two shot attempts and Allmaras tallied two saves. In addition, senior defender and team captain Evyn Hewett played all 90 minutes and completed the season by playing every minute of every match on the back line for the Aztecs (1,725).

 

SDSU outshot UCLA in the first half, 4-3, before the Bruins eventually finished the match with a 9-7 edge in shots. The two teams had four corner kicks apiece, as San Diego State completed the season with a 4-4 record when either tied or ahead in corner kicks. The Aztecs were a perfect 3-0 this season when having more corner kicks than the opposition.

 

San Diego State’s 7 home victories this season are tied for the most wins at SDSU Sports Deck since 2006 (8). The Aztecs went 6-3 in non-conference play, and are now 18-5-2 in non-conference home matches since the beginning of the 2010 season. In addition, SDSU went 6-2 in matches this season when scoring first, 7-4 when either ahead or tied at halftime, and 5-1 when either outshooting or tied in shots attempted.  

 

The Aztecs finished the 2014 campaign with three victories over ranked opponents, as they’ve played five matches against teams ranked in the top 10 of the NSCAA Coaches Poll, and 13 contests against teams who were ranked at some point this season.

 

Man of the Match: Senior Henrik Synnes (Vigra, Norway) was named Man of the Match on Sunday afternoon, as he closed out his career on Montezuma Road by playing all 90 minutes and recording one shot. Synnes appeared in 21 career matches in an Aztec uniform with seven starts, recording two goals.
